Irish Cream Corn Recipe
Ingredients:
- 2 Bags frozen corn (16oz Bags, thawed)
- 3 Tbsp Butter
- ½ Onion (small diced)
- 1 Roasted Red Bell Pepper (Jarred is fine)
- 1 cup Heavy Cream
- 1 Tbsp Parsley (chopped)
- 2 teaspoons cornstarch (equal parts water for a slurry)
- 1-2 Tbsp sugar (to taste)
- Salt and Pepper (to taste)
Directions:
- In a saucepan sweat onion in butter over medium heat.
- Add corn and red bell pepper and sauté for several minutes, stirring occasionally.
- Add the cream gradually, stirring constantly.
- Slowly add the cornstarch slurry, stirring constantly.
- Continue cooking over low heat until thickened, about 5 minutes.
- Add sugar, salt, and pepper to taste; add parsley.
